Assist the Chef de Partie in managing a designated kitchen section (e.g. grill pastry larder).
Prepare ingredients cook menu items and ensure dishes meet quality and presentation standards.
Follow recipes portion controls and cost guidelines.
Support the kitchen team during service to maintain efficiency and timing.
Maintain cleanliness and organization of workstations.
Monitor stock levels and report shortages to the Chef de Partie or Sous Chef.
Properly store food items and ensure correct labeling and rotation (FIFO).
Identify and report maintenance or equipment issues.
Qualifications :
Previous experience as a Chef de Partie or similar role (usually 12 years).
Strong knowledge of basic cooking techniques and kitchen operations.
Ability to work efficiently under pressure.
Good communication teamwork and time-management skills.
Understanding of food hygiene and safety standards.
A culinary qualification is an advantage but not always required.
